Introduction to Pixel-Perfect Platformers
Definition and Characteristics
Pixel-perfect platformers are a distinct genre characterized by their meticulous attention to visual detail and precise gameplay mechanics. He often finds that these games feature vibrant pixel art, which enhances the nostalgic feel while providing a unique aesthetic experience. This art style allows for expressive character designs and immersive environments. Additionally, the gameplay typically emphasizes tight controls and responsive actions, which are crucial for navigating challenging levels. Such precision can lead to a rewarding experience. Many players appreciate the skill required to master these games. They often evoke a sense of accomplishment.
Historical Context
The emergence of pixel-perfect platformers can be traced back to the early days of video gaming, where limited graphical capabilities necessitated a focus on simplicity and clarity. He recognizes that this historical context laid the groundwork for a resurgence in indie game development. As technology advanced, developers began to leverage nostalgia while incorporating modern design principles. This blend has created a unique market segment that appeals to both retro enthusiasts and new players. Level Design Principles
Level design principles are critical in pixel-perfect platformers, as they shape the player’s experience and engagement. He notes that effective level design balances challenge and accessibility, ensuring players remain motivated. Each level should introduce new mechanics gradually, allowing players to adapt. This progression keeps the gameplay fresh and exciting. Additionally, visual cues within the environment can guide players intuitively. Clear pathways and obstacles enhance navigation. Gameplay Mechanics and Innovations
Core Mechanics of Platforming
Core mechanics of platforming are essential for creating engaging gameplay experiences in pixel-perfect platformers. He notes that precise jumping, running, and climbing mechanics form the foundation of this genre. These mechanics must be responsive to ensure player satisfaction. Additionally, innovative features, such as wall-jumping or double-jumping, can enhance gameplay depth. This variety encourages players to experiment with different strategies.
